The e92 indeed has a unique soul. Will never be another m3 like it again. I just went from an f82 stage 1 with m performance exhaust for just over 4 years to an f87 cs. The steering feel alone is miles better. I had the gts flash on the m4 but it still has the dead zone to some degree. In terms of suspension, I was running Bilstein b16d on the m4 so this is definitely more compliant. The cs came with kw has which I'm enjoying for now. I actually like the cs exhaust tone (no burbles) but it's extremely tame compared to the m performance. Getting the full AA signature tomorrow 🔥 🤗
